Rotkohl (Spiced Red Cabbage)

ingredients
- 1 (24 ounce) jar of prepared red cabbage
- 3 whole cloves
- 1 whole bay leaf
- 3 allspice berries
- 6 juniper berries
- 1 tablespoon lard
- 1 tablespoon sweet vermouth
- salt (to taste)
- sugar (to taste)
- 12 ounces water
directions
- Heat the lard over medium heat in a sauce pan.
- While the lard is heating, grind cloves, allspice berries, and juniper berries in a spice grinder or mortar and pestle.
- When lard is melted, add red cabbage, and spice mixture.
- Fill empty cabbage jar half way with water and pour into sauce pan.
- Add a splash of the sweet vermouth.
- Boil for 30-45 minutes, stirring frequently.
- After most of the water is evaporated, add salt and sugar to taste.
- Either eat hot or put it in the fridge and eat cold.
